Parque Central East Tower (Caracas)

Venezuela / Miranda / Chacao / Caracas
 skyscraper, mixed-used building

Official name: Parque Central Torre Este
Height (struct.): 221 m (725 ft)
Floors (OG): 56
Construction end: 1979

Tallest building in Caracas and Venezuela, along with its twin tower.
On October 17, 2004, at least ten floors of the building caught fire. The main focus of the fire was in the 34th floor and flames reached the 44th floor of the building.
From 2005-2006, the tower was renovated, the structure was reinforced, and new security systems were installed.
